Ticket: FERRO-2214 — partner SFTP drop misconfigured in staging. The Oakmere ingest service was reading the production drop path because staging's env file was copied without edits. I've corrected the host and path entries and confirmed the nightly pull targets the sandbox drop. One item remains for review: the staging file still lacks the partner credential. Reviewer, please verify the entry appended immediately below this line.

vault entry, yahaf-tagug: LEDGER_TOKEN20=884d77d1a8b98aa4edfb

## Further Reading: Rounding in Currency Conversion

If you're wondering why Coinloom stores amounts in minor units and converts with banker's rounding, you're not the first. We learned the hard way when the Verdalia ledger drifted by a few cents per thousand transactions and reconciliation became a nightmare. The write-up covers rounding modes, precision rules, and the reconciliation job. It's all documented on the internal page below.

runbook for badug-kadup: https://confluence.zemvarlabs.internal/projects/browse/display/projects/bd1b

## Releases

Hey support folks — quick notes on ProfileMesh shard releases. Each release re-balances user-profile shards gradually, so don't panic if a lookup lands on a stale shard for a few minutes post-deploy; it self-heals. Release bundles are published twice a month and are always signed. If a customer asks you to verify a bundle they downloaded, walk them through the checksum step using the public signing key below.

deploy key for kawif-bageg: bky19_YQNdHDgpaLxUNwPoHm9

Audit item 14 — LiftSim dispatch simulator. Verify the cab-assignment log matches the scheduler output for the last 30 days. Check that peak-hour scenarios (Vertora Tower profile) replay without drift. Confirm the hall-call queue never exceeds 12 pending entries during stress runs. Flag any mismatch between simulated door-dwell times and config defaults. Support should not patch configs directly; escalate all discrepancies via the Orvane queue. Sign-off on this item belongs to the person named below.

approver of yahif-hahif = Wenwyn Eliael